Kunjabiharipur is a rural settlement in Motunga, Dhenkanal, Odisha. It has a population of 531 in about 117 households (avg size: 4.54). Approximate literacy: 67.04%.

Population of Kunjabiharipur

Population (Total)531
Male269
Female262
Children (0–6 years)78
Households117
Literate persons356
Illiterate persons175
Total workers300
Sex ratio (♀ per 1000 ♂)974
Literacy (approx.)67.04%
SC population154
ST population371
